• Start a peer education program on sexual and teen dating violence.
  • Ask your school library to buy books about sexual violence and teen dating violence.
  • Create bulletin boards in the school cafeteria or classroom to raise awareness.
  • Do not condone, allow or tolerate sexual harassment in your school.
  • Speak out against harassment, and report it to a responsible adult when you see it.
  • Talk to your local crisis, sexual assault, rape crisis or women's center and learn about sexual violence. Ask workers to come and speak to your school.
  • Talk to your local domestic violence center and learn about teen dating violence. Ask workers to present at your school.
  • Take a stand against sexual and teen dating violence.
